Su Jiangping, project manager of the power supply and distribution construction area of Xiangli Expressway; unsmiling, taciturn, wearing glasses, dark skin, a standard image of a front-line technical personnel in the project, "strict with oneself, lenient with others" is his motto. He is the person who gets up earliest and sleeps latest in the project department. During the day, he shuttles through the construction site, strictly controlling the construction quality and progress. He personally checks every light connection, street lamp assembly, grounding strap welding, and high and low voltage cabinet debugging. In the evening, he returns to the project department to study drawings and summarize the daily problems on the site. He personally checks every item of work, every detail, including materials, contracts, safety, and internal documents, before submitting them with peace of mind. In his spare time, he leads the management personnel of the project department to learn standards and drawings, and guides new college graduates to calculate engineering quantities, prepare material plans, write special construction schemes, and construction organization designs, carefully cultivating reserve talents.

November 11, 2020, was the day Su Jiangping's youngest daughter was born. However, the Xiangli Expressway project had a tight schedule and heavy tasks. He only returned to his wife's side two days before the expected delivery date, on November 9th. After his daughter was born, he not only had to take care of his wife and daughter but also remotely command the project's work arrangements. When his daughter was awake, he took care of her; when she was asleep, he immediately opened his computer to handle work; he rushed to school to pick up his eldest son after school. He only slept three or four hours a day. A week later, unable to rest easy about the project, Su Jiangping arranged for his family to take care of his wife and daughter, and proactively gave up the remaining more than 20 days of paternity leave. He said goodbye to his wife and newborn daughter in confinement and returned to his post at Xiangli. He said, "I also want to accompany my wife and daughter through confinement, but as a project manager, I need to ensure the completion of the project by the end of the year and cannot leave my post. So many employees are sticking to the front line without holidays, how can I rest assured to take a vacation? I can only apologize to my wife and children. After the two sections are successfully opened to traffic, I will go back and accompany them."
